In addition, MEPs say that market-based emissions reduction policies are not enough, so they also introduced binding requirements for shipping companies to reduce their annual average CO2 emissions per transport work, for all their ships, by at least 40% by 2030. Maritime transport remains the only sector with no specific EU commitments to reduce greenhouse gas emissions. In 2015 in the EU, 13% of the overall EU greenhouse gas emissions came from the transport sector.
